Output 87496860233a5c25edce6589316810815b324020d99e1c967be4ef337d350912:0

value
1148162
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d083a5cb1c29cf7014d0e7b5413bafc1ffef7463 OP_EQUAL
address
3LhYBUvPSgDgSZy9oJp7pBwdxrBGZhTcWP
transaction
87496860233a5c25edce6589316810815b324020d99e1c967be4ef337d350912
confirmations
133011
spent
true